Gas Gauge Guzzlers: What Makes Fuel Expensive
Determining the price at the pump is a complex puzzle, influenced by a variety of factors. Crude oil prices, regularly considered the most significant factor, fluctuate based on global supply and demand. Geopolitical events, natural disasters, and economic trends can all impact crude oil prices, causing changes at the pump. Refining costs, which include personnel and maintenance, also play a role, as furthermore government regulations and taxes.
li The cost of gasoline can vary significantly from state to state due to differences in tax rates. |li Government regulations on fuel production and distribution can impact prices at the pump. |li Consumer demand, seasonal factors, and holidays can all influence gas prices.
Additionally, fluctuating currency values can affect the cost of imported crude oil, adding another layer to the complexity.

From Crude Oil to Car Engine: The Petrol Production Process
The journey of petrol, from raw oil deep underground to the fuel powering your car, is a fascinating journey. It all begins with obtaining crude oil through drilling rigs. This viscous liquid is then transported to refineries, where it undergoes a series of complex chemical processes. First, the crude oil is separated into different components based on their boiling points. Next, these parts are purified to remove impurities and create various petroleum products, including gasoline.
The processed gasoline is then mixed with additives to enhance its performance and durability. Finally, the finished petrol is shipped to gas stations, ready to be used in car engines, providing the energy needed for transportation.
